No difference between what happened on May 9, what was done by India: Maryam Nawaz

Sargodha: Chief Minister (CM) Punjab Maryam Nawaz has said there is no big difference between what happened on May 9 and what was done by India.

" there can be difference with the personality. But on May 9 military installations were set ablaze. Our military installations were their target. What this party did could be done by enemy in decades. The uniforms which were insulted, those youths elevated Pakistan prestige in comity of nations, she said this while addressing Honhar scholarship and lap top distribution ceremony in University of Sargodha Thursday.

She held the future of Pakistan is not robust and safe hands. Youths are real wall of the country.

The way we keep lap top secure and safe so that no virus comes in, the mind has to be kept safe and secure this way so that no political virus comes therein, she added.

She underlined that the children who were misled are in jail today. Never take step against motherland. Youths should refrain from becoming fuel to chaos. Where are those today who have put me into death cell and where are we.

We will have to use freedom of expression with responsibility. Character assassination is made in fake news factories in the country. It is my request not to spread fake news. Verification be made first.
